K2’s Excel Tips – Today’s Best Features

Course - K2's Excel Tips - Today's Best Features

Major Topics

  • New features and functions in Excel
  • How to improve efficiency and effectiveness when working in Excel
  • Taking advantage of Copilot integration with Excel
  • Better ways of creating and working with formulas

Learning Objectives

  1. List examples of key new features in Excel and how and why business professionals can take advantage of these tools
  2. Identify use cases for Excel’s PIVOTBY and GROUPBY functions
  3. Specify how Office Scripts differ from traditional Excel macros
  4. Cite examples of using Copilot in conjunction with Excel
  5. List examples of new opportunities to collaborate with others using Excel

Description

Wow! So many new Excel features and so little time! Microsoft continues to add tremendous functionality to Excel – the business professional’s tool of choice. Yet most Excel users have not discovered these new tools and remain mired in yesterday’s practices for working in Excel. In this session, you will learn how to use many of Excel’s latest features to work more efficiently and effectively with your spreadsheets.

Participate in this session to learn about recently released features such as PIVOTBY, GROUPBY, Office Scripts, integration with Copilot, new ways to share and collaborate in Excel, and data entry and formula improvements. If you work with Excel – and who doesn’t – this session is necessary to help you improve your efficiency and effectiveness when using Excel.
